K8F Modular Impact Crusher Plant
Product Parameters
| Parameter | Unit | |
| Feeding Device - Hopper Capacity | m3 | 5 |
| Feeding Device - Vibrating Motor Power | kW | 2*5.5 |
| Crushing unit - Maximum Feed Particle Size | mm | 600 |
| Crushing unit - Crusher Power | kW | 250 |
| Main Conveyor - Belt Width | mm | B1000 |
| Main Conveyor - Drive Motor Power | kW | 15 |
| Transit Conveyor - Belt Width | mm | B500 |
| Transit Conveyor - Drive Motor Power | kW | 3 |
| Return Conveyor - Belt Width | mm | B650 |
| Return Conveyor - Drive Motor Power | kW | 5.5 |
| Crushed Material Conveyor - Belt Width | mm | B1000 |
| Crushed Material Conveyor - Drive Motor Power | kW | 7.5 |
| End Discharge Conveyor (Optional) - Belt Width | mm | B500 |
| End Discharge Conveyor (Optional) - Drive Motor Power | kW | 4 |
| Vibrating Screen - Number of Screen Decks | 1 | |
| Vibrating Screen - Screen Area | mm | 4500*1500 |
| Overall Machine - Total Weight | t | 38.5 |
| Overall Machine - Total Power | kW | 315 |
| Overall Machine - Capacity | t/h | 150-250 |
| Overall Machine - Working Dimensions | m | 18.3×5.4×4.8 |
| Overall Machine - Transport Dimensions | Disassembly and Transportation |

Powerful Crushing Unit
The crusher unit optimally integrates a scalping rotor, high-wear-resistant materials, and a well-engineered crushing chamber design. This significantly enhances processing capacity, improves final product gradation, and reduces wear costs. It is equipped with a fully hydraulic impact plate and discharge gap adjustment device for more convenient operation.

Intelligent Feeding System
The vibrating feeder utilizes automatic variable-frequency feeding. By monitoring the crusher motor load, it adjusts the feed rate to control the main unit's workload, thereby reducing the risk of equipment failure.
